{"id":702,"date":"2014-07-03T12:21:03","date_gmt":"2014-07-03T06:51:03","guid":{"rendered":"https:\/\/www.inogic.com\/blog\/?p=702"},"modified":"2021-12-14T15:54:32","modified_gmt":"2021-12-14T10:24:32","slug":"server-based-sharepoint-integration-for-microsoft-dynamics-crm","status":"publish","type":"post","link":"https:\/\/www.inogic.com\/blog\/2014\/07\/server-based-sharepoint-integration-for-microsoft-dynamics-crm\/","title":{"rendered":"Server-based SharePoint integration for Microsoft Dynamics CRM"},"content":{"rendered":"<p style=\"text-align: justify;\"><strong><span style=\"text-decoration: underline;\">Introduction<\/span>:<\/strong><\/p>\n<p style=\"text-align: justify;\">With the Spring Release of CRM 2013, we now also have Server-side sync available for Dynamics CRM and Microsoft Sharepoint Online.<\/p>\n<p style=\"text-align: justify;\">Yes it did support Sharepoint integration in the earlier release too but as the name suggests Server-side synchronization will now handle automatic authentication between CRM and Sharepoint. The credentials that you used to login to Dynamics CRM would be used to log you in automatically to Sharepoint as well. This does mean that both CRM and Sharepoint should be on the same tenant.<\/p>\n<p style=\"text-align: justify;\">Ex.<\/p>\n<p style=\"text-align: justify;\">CRM Online URL<\/p>\n<p style=\"text-align: justify;\">Org.crm.dynamics.com<\/p>\n<p style=\"text-align: justify;\">Sharepoint URL<\/p>\n<p style=\"text-align: justify;\">Org.sharepoint.com<\/p>\n<p style=\"text-align: justify;\">You will not be able to enable Server-Side sync unless the org name of both CRM and Sharepoint are the same. This is the primary requirement to enable Server-Side sync.<\/p>\n<p style=\"text-align: justify;\">This leads to the fact that Server-side sync only supports sync between Online instances and not hybrid integration between CRM &amp; Sharepoint.<\/p>\n<p style=\"text-align: justify;\">The other change that comes along is that in the earlier versions of integration, you were required to install a List component on Sharepoint so that it could be integrated with Dynamics CRM. You should upgrade to Server-Side sync as the tooltip on the this option states that future versions of sharepoint would disable the List component feature on which the earlier integration was based.<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img1.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-703\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img1.jpg\" alt=\"img1\" width=\"624\" height=\"66\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">Once you have your CRM Online upgraded to Spring Update, you will see this yellow notification bar for Configuring Server-Side sync.<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img1.2.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-713\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img1.2.jpg\" alt=\"img1.2\" width=\"623\" height=\"36\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">Currently there is no way to disable this notification until you actually configure the integration L<\/p>\n<p style=\"text-align: justify;\"><strong><span style=\"text-decoration: underline;\">Configuration<\/span>:<\/strong><\/p>\n<p style=\"text-align: justify;\">Under Settings &#8211;&gt;\u00a0Document Management you would find the new option to enable Server-side Sync:<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img2.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-704\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img2.jpg\" alt=\"img2\" width=\"623\" height=\"178\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">The steps for enabling Server-Side remain the same, you need to provide the SharePoint URL to begin with and this url should be on the same O365 tenant as CRM Online.<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img3.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-705\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img3.jpg\" alt=\"img3\" width=\"536\" height=\"599\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">Enter in the valid Sharepoint URL to get to the next screen that returns the validation results. All validations must be passed to proceed further<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img4.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-706\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img4.jpg\" alt=\"img4\" width=\"536\" height=\"599\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">Once the Sharepoint instance has been validated you can proceed with configuring the Document libraries for the required entities. These steps remain the same and have been explained in our earlier blog on this subject and can be found here <a href=\"https:\/\/www.inogic.com\/blog\/2013\/04\/how-to-integrate-sharepoint-online-with-crm-online-part-2-integration-of-crm-and-sharepoint-online\/\">https:\/\/www.inogic.com\/blog\/2013\/04\/how-to-integrate-sharepoint-online-with-crm-online-part-2-integration-of-crm-and-sharepoint-online\/<\/a><\/p>\n<p style=\"text-align: justify;\">After configuration, navigating to the entity enabled for document management would show up the following screen:<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img5.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-707\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img5.jpg\" alt=\"img5\" width=\"742\" height=\"150\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">In comparison to the earlier List control that would be displayed<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img6.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-708\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img6.jpg\" alt=\"img6\" width=\"456\" height=\"135\" \/><\/a><\/p>\n<p style=\"text-align: justify;\">Selecting a document would bring up all of the native sharepoint document version management features<\/p>\n<p style=\"text-align: justify;\"><a href=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img7.jpg\"><img decoding=\"async\" class=\"alignnone size-full wp-image-709\" src=\"https:\/\/www.inogic.com\/blog\/wp-content\/uploads\/2014\/07\/img7.jpg\" alt=\"img7\" width=\"756\" height=\"155\" \/><\/a><\/p>\n<p style=\"text-align: justify;\"><strong><span style=\"text-decoration: underline;\">Conclusion<\/span>:<\/strong><\/p>\n<p style=\"text-align: justify;\">If you are on CRM Online and are using Sharepoint Integration with Sharepoint Online, it is time to re-configure your integration to be Server-based with the introduction of this feature. This would also bring in a rich full-featured Sharepoint integration where you would be able to perform all document management actions from right within CRM without having to perform these actions in Sharepoint. Now that\u2019s what an integration should let you do.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Introduction: With the Spring Release of CRM 2013, we now also have Server-side sync available for Dynamics CRM and Microsoft Sharepoint Online. Yes it did support Sharepoint integration in the earlier release too but as the name suggests Server-side synchronization will now handle automatic authentication between CRM and Sharepoint. The credentials that you used to\u2026 <span class=\"read-more\"><a href=\"https:\/\/www.inogic.com\/blog\/2014\/07\/server-based-sharepoint-integration-for-microsoft-dynamics-crm\/\">Read More &raquo;<\/a><\/span><\/p>\n","protected":false},"author":13,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"om_disable_all_campaigns":false,"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"categories":[21,22,24,31,53],"tags":[1618],"class_list":["post-702","post","type-post","status-publish","format-standard","hentry","category-dynamics-crm-2013","category-dynamics-crm-2015","category-dynamics-crm-2016","category-integrations-dynamics-crm","category-sharepoint","tag-sharepoint-online"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/posts\/702","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/users\/13"}],"replies":[{"embeddable":true,"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/comments?post=702"}],"version-history":[{"count":0,"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/posts\/702\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/media?parent=702"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/categories?post=702"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.inogic.com\/blog\/wp-json\/wp\/v2\/tags?post=702"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}